Here’s a great Scottish tune that to my best knowledge, was originally written in D. Anyway, since learning it in E (too many years ago 😅) I can’t go back 🤣 00:00 Intro and warm ups 00:35 Learner version 01:58 Session version This is a great entry tune to learning how to play a somewhat flashy piece in 3rd position on your fiddle or violin. The trick, is all about practicing the shift, between G# and the B with your 2nd (middle) finger. The best part about trying your position shift with this particular tune, is that you can do the actual shift whilst playing the open E. I recommend following the warm ups, followed by integrating rhe shift carefully into the learner version, until it all starts to sound and feel steady. I also recommend oating attention to, and following the bow strokes here as well, it will make it easier in the long run!
